인프런 커뮤니티 질문&답변

dalim508님의 프로필 이미지
dalim508

작성한 질문수

따라하며 배우는 노드, 리액트 시리즈 - 기본 강의

userSchema.methods 부분이 궁금해서 질문드립니다.

작성

·

152

0

먼저 강의를 제공해주셔서 감사합니다.
공부하다가 궁금한 부분이 있어서 질문드립니다.
 
user.comparePassword부분을 만들어준 후 , User.js부분에 userSchema.methods를 사용하여 함수를 만들어주는데 그럴 필요없이 그냥 index.js에서 user.comparePassword부분에 비밀번호가 같은지 확인할 수 있는 함수를 바로 만들면 되는 거 아닌가요? 굳이 userSchema.methods를 거쳐서 함수를 만들어주는 이유는 무엇인가요?

답변 1

1

John Ahn님의 프로필 이미지
John Ahn
지식공유자

안녕하세요 !!! 

this.password로 현재 디비에 들어있는 데이터를 손쉽게 가져올수있기 때문입니다.
감사합니다 !!

dalim508님의 프로필 이미지
dalim508

작성한 질문수

질문하기